Output fef3eceeb61cd552fea9f3a55fa2003d7909b07c29f85b6aa3b817d818047117:6

value
21689824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b63ffae158665b997e037dcd8b853e261e7effa OP_EQUAL
address
32jF9guYZEGa3F4h3xiPgCXDbsMoagHjS1
transaction
fef3eceeb61cd552fea9f3a55fa2003d7909b07c29f85b6aa3b817d818047117
confirmations
171334
spent
true